Output f5926436d839436ab2394643131d883945a66c5fce806441ebf191cccbeb4af2:20

value
5808108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e085f90469500f92540bddd2e75c9b8442fec6d OP_EQUAL
address
MHvxbKQy1NE9K2C1sU5LH5coZFvSZoqjtB
transaction
f5926436d839436ab2394643131d883945a66c5fce806441ebf191cccbeb4af2
spent
true